I've just ordered a GA-M720-US3 rev 1.0  and Phenom II X2 550.

The CPU support list says I need BIOS revision F5 to run this processor. If the motherboard I receive has an older BIOS, will it refuse to POST or will it allow me to flash the BIOS from a USB stick?

Your system should boot up OK with older bios, just CPU may not be properly recognized.
Then you will need to update bios by Q-Flash, see the guide here:
